AUSTRALIAN GOOD FOOD GUIDE - Home of the Chef Hat Awards

Mullumbimby Providores With Organic Options

Byron Bay Pickle Palooza, located in the charming suburb of Mullumbimby in New South Wales's Northern Rivers region, offers a delectable escape for food enthusiasts. This unique providore showcases...